Hey guys I have a 95 LS with 208k. Somtimes when I am driving and I am shifting from 1-2 or 2-3 I will get a lil popping sound as the rpms are going up, also say I am doing 30-40 and i put in 4th and cruise at that speed and than stepping on the gas to pick up speed i feel the car sputtering and hesiation a little bit. Its a lot worse if i have the AC on. It had never acted like this, and I had my timing/waterpump etc. done a few months back at Radley Acura.

Are you getting any CEL codes? There are a lot of things that could cause hesitation. When was the last time you did a tune up on the motor? Inspect spark plugs and you might want to try using some Seafoam.
No its not throwing any codes...but you are right...i havent given it a tune up since last summer and used seafoam at that time.
